http://www.state.gov/secretary/rm/2001/933.htm
from 2-24-01
quote:
"We had a good discussion, the Foreign Minister and I and the President and I, had a good discussion about the nature of the sanctions -- the fact that the sanctions exist -- not for the purpose of hurting the Iraqi people, but for the purpose of keeping in check Saddam Hussein's ambitions toward developing weapons of mass destruction. We should constantly be reviewing our policies, constantly be looking at those sanctions to make sure that they are directed toward that purpose. That purpose is every bit as important now as it was ten years ago when we began it. And frankly they have worked. He has not developed any significant capability with respect to weapons of mass destruction. He is unable to project conventional power against his neighbors. So in effect, our policies have strengthened the security of the neighbors of Iraq, and these are policies that we are going to keep in place, but we are always willing to review them to make sure that they are being carried out in a way that does not affect the Iraqi people but does affect the Iraqi regime's ambitions and the ability to acquire weapons of mass destruction, and we had a good conversation on this issue."

COLIN FREAKING POWELL

It's a shame that "moderate" Republicans are so hard to find these days.

There's a difference here. Not many people die because of a wrong Super Bowl bet (go Pats!) and while those horrible hot dogs you can buy at games are probably as lethal as depleted uranium shell splinters, that's where the similarity ends.

As I see it the accusations of lying fall into the following categories:

1) That Saddam was a threat to world peace.

This is so laughable that, to continue the football metaphor, it's like claiming the Buffalo Bills will win the Super Bowl.

Fact: Even before Gulf War I Saddam was at most capable of invading his neighbours.

2) That Saddam was a threat to his neighbours.

Fact: After Gulf War I Saddam was contained, had no air force and would have been crushed had he decided to attack anyone. He was like a beaten dog.

Fact: none of the neighbours apart from Israel wanted the war, so they must have felt really threatened. Anyone suggesting that Israel felt threatened by Iraq needs their head examined.

Fact: if Saddam ever attempted to attack Israel with chemical warheads, the response would be nuclear (the Israelis have made that quite clear).

3) That Saddam had a nuclear program.

Fact: you can't just make nuclear weapons. You need enough electricity to power a small city as well as wads and wads of cash.

Fact: he may have wanted nukes but he couldn't make them while undere such stringent surveillance and even if he got them he could only use them for defensive purposes.

Fact: you can't just make nuclear weapons. You need enough electricity to power a small city as well as wads and wads of cash and specialist equipment. Unless you have a closed society like North Korea, it's pretty hard to hide them. Everyone knows Israel had them despite that country's refusal to confirm it.

Anyone can get documents relating to the construction of nuclear weapons if they really want them. You can probably get them at any university library or on the internet. But without a lot of money and industrial capacity - you ain't getting any nukes.

4) That Saddam had weapons of mass destruction.

Fact: unless he had nukes, it's not worth worrying about. Chemical weapons are a battlefield weapon for use against mass infantry. They are wholly useless for anything else. Why did Saddam have them in the first place? Because he was facing massed infantry attacks from Iran. Why is vastly more money spent on nuclear weapons than chemical weapons? Because nuclear weapons actually work. If you want to see how useless chemical weapons are, look at the Tokyo subway attack. A nail bomb would have killed more people.

Fact: bio weapons don't work either. Smallpox could be contained by a mass vaccination program and anthrax is next to useless. What was the death toll from anthrax in the US? Four or five people. It's also increasingly unlikely that Saddam had access to smallpox since it was eradicated in the wild before he came to power.

Summary: no serious person believed he had nukes or was close to developing them. It doesn't fit the facts. No serious person believed that even if he did have chemical or bio weapons that these were all that threatening. BECAUSE THEY ARE NEXT TO USELESS. If he did have them, we shouldn't worry that much.

EVEN IF HE HAD CHEMICAL OR BIO-WEAPONS, ITS NO BIG DEAL SINCE HE COULDN'T DO JACK WITH THEM.

5) That Saddam would give weapons of mass destruction to "terrorists".

fact: al Quaeda is an organization that is devoted to overthrowing secular Arab leaders.

fact: Saddam Hussein was a secular Arab leader. What reason would he have for helping people committed to his own destruction?

fact: only an idiot would believe that Saddam would give a terrorist organization a nuclear weapon (if he ever got one) that he had spent millions of dollars and risked his life on. There is a reasonable chance of such a weapon being traced after its use and of Iraq being destroyed by massive retaliation. Again, not something Saddam would go for.

fact: if terrorists wanted chemical weapons they could make them themselves as the Aum cult did. There is no need for them to go begging to Saddam. In any case THEY DON'T WORK.

fact: if terrorists managed to get bio weapons there is little reason to think that they could do much more damage than the anthrax guy. The Aum cult tried bio weapons and guess what: THEY DIDN'T WORK. There's a reason 99% of funds go to nukes - NUKES WORK.

Unless Bush and Blair are complete morons, they know all this. They both deliberately gave the impression that Iraq was a threat. But even the most cursory visit to your local library and a basic knowledge of history and world politics is enough to show you that they were full of ****.
